Eligibility
- Under section 22(8) of the Public Service Act 1999, employees must be Australian citizens to be employed in the Australian Public Service (APS).
- Applicants must have a Certificate III or higher in Business/Government or equivalent. (See notes below)
This recruitment process is being used to fill ongoing positions.
Ex-serving members may be able to apply for a Certificate III or higher in Business/Government as recognised prior learning through the Defence RTO by contacting the ADF Transition & Civil Recognition service. Members having transitioned within 18 months will be considered for eligible qualifications. Veterans with an earlier discharge date will be considered on a case by case basis and require evidence of ongoing employment relating to certification. You can contact this service by writing to:
